MCU 8-bit PIC18 PIC RISC 8KB Flash 2.5V/3.3V/5V 28-Pin SOIC W Tube, PIC18LF2320-I/SO, Microchip

PIC18LF2320 offers the advantages of all PIC18 microcontrollers ñ namely, high computational performance at an economical price with the addition of highendurance Enhanced Flash program memory. On top of these features, the PIC18F2220/2320/4220/4320 family introduces design enhancements that make these microcontrollers a logical choice for many high-performance, power sensitive applications. All of the devices in the PIC18F2220/2320/4220/4320 family incorporate a range of features that can significantly reduce power consumption during operation Alternate Run Modes: By clocking the controller from the Timer1 source or the internal oscillator block, power consumption during code execution can be reduced by as much as 90% Multiple Idle Modes: The controller can also run with its CPU core disabled, but the peripherals are still active. In these states, power consumption can be reduced even further, to as little as 4%, of normal operation requirements. On-the-Fly Mode Switching: The power-managed modes are invoked by user code during operation, allowing the user to incorporate power-saving ideas into their applicationís software design. Lower Consumption in Key Modules: The power requirements for both Timer1 and the Watchdog Timer have been reduced by up to 80%, with typical values of 1.8 and 2.2 µA, respectively. All of the devices in the PIC18F2220/2320/4220/4320 family offer nine different oscillator options, allowing users a wide range of choices in developing application hardware. These include: ï Four Crystal modes using crystals or ceramic resonators. ï Two External Clock modes offering the option of using two pins (oscillator input and a divide-by-4 clock output) or one pin (oscillator input with the second pin reassigned as general I/O). ï Two External RC Oscillator modes with the same pin options as the External Clock modes. ï An internal oscillator block, which provides a 31 kHz INTRC clock and an 8 MHz clock with 6 program selectable divider ratios (4 MHz to 125 kHz) for a total of 8 clock frequencies Besides its availability as a clock source, the internal oscillator block provides a stable reference source that gives the family additional features for robust operation: Fail-Safe Clock Monitor: This option constantly monitors the main clock source against a reference signal provided by the internal oscillator. If a clock failure occurs, the controller is switched to the internal oscillator block, allowing for continued low-speed operation or a safe application shutdown. Two-Speed Start-up: This option allows the internal oscillator to serve as the clock source from Power-on Reset, or wake-up from Sleep mode, until the primary clock source is available. This allows for code execution during what would otherwise be the clock start-up interval and can even allow an application to perform routine background activities and return to Sleep without returning to full power operation. Memory Endurance: The Enhanced Flash cells for both program memory and data EEPROM are rated to last for many thousands of erase/write cycles ñ up to 100,000 for program memory and 1,000,000 for EEPROM. Data retention without refresh is conservatively estimated to be greater than 40 years

  • Low-Power Features:
  • Power-Managed modes:
    • Run: CPU on, peripherals on
    • Idle: CPU off, peripherals on
    • Sleep: CPU off, peripherals off
  • Power Consumption modes:
    • PRI_RUN: 150 µA, 1 MHz, 2V
    • PRI_IDLE: 37 µA, 1 MHz, 2V
    • SEC_RUN: 14 µA, 32 kHz, 2V
    • SEC_IDLE: 5.8 µA, 32 kHz, 2V
    • RC_RUN: 110 µA, 1 MHz, 2V
    • RC_IDLE: 52 µA, 1 MHz, 2V
    • Sleep: 0.1 µA, 1 MHz, 2V
  • Timer1 Oscillator: 1.1 µA, 32 kHz, 2V
  • Watchdog Timer: 2.1 µA
  • Two-Speed Oscillator Start-up Oscillators:
  • Four Crystal modes:
    • LP, XT, HS: up to 25 MHz
    • HSPLL: 4-10 MHz (16-40 MHz internal)
  • Two External RC modes, Up to 4 MHz
  • Two External Clock modes, Up to 40 MHz
  • Internal Oscillator Block:
    • 8 user-selectable frequencies: 31 kHz, 125 kHz, 250 kHz, 500 kHz, 1 MHz, 2 MHz, 4 MHz, 8 MHz
    • 125 kHz-8 MHz calibrated to 1%
    • Two modes select one or two I/O pins
    • OSCTUNE Allows user to shift frequency
  • Secondary Oscillator using Timer1 @ 32 kHz
  • Fail-Safe Clock Monitor
    • Allows for safe shutdown if peripheral clock stops
  • Peripheral Highlights:
  • High-Current Sink/Source 25 mA/25 mA
  • Three External Interrupts
  • Up to 2 Capture/Compare/PWM (CCP) modules:
    • Capture is 16-bit, max. resolution is 6.25 ns (TCY/16)
    • Compare is 16-bit, max. resolution is 100 ns (TCY)
    • PWM output: PWM resolution is 1 to 10-bit
  • Enhanced Capture/Compare/PWM (ECCP) module:
    • One, two or four PWM outputs
    • Selectable polarity
    • Programmable dead time
    • Auto-Shutdown and Auto-Restart
  • Compatible 10-Bit, Up to 13-Channel Analog-to-Digital Converter (A/D) module with Programmable Acquisition Time
  • Dual Analog Comparators
  • Addressable USART module:
    • RS-232 operation using internal oscillator block (no external crystal required) Special Microcontroller Features:
  • 100,000 Erase/Write Cycle Enhanced Flash Program Memory Typical
  • 1,000,000 Erase/Write Cycle Data EEPROM Memory Typical
  • Flash/Data EEPROM Retention: > 40 Years
  • Self-Programmable under Software Control
  • Priority Levels for Interrupts
  • 8 x 8 Single-Cycle Hardware Multiplier
  • Extended Watchdog Timer (WDT):
    • Programmable period from 41 ms to 131s
    • 2% stability over VDD and Temperature
  • Single-Supply 5V In-Circuit Serial Programmingô (ICSPô) via Two Pins
  • In-Circuit Debug (ICD) via Two Pins
  • Wide Operating Voltage Range: 2.0V to 5.5V

Характеристики

Analog_comparators

2

Operating_supply_voltage

2.5, 3.3, 5 V

Min_operating_supply_voltage

2 V

Max_operating_supply_voltage

5.5 V

Watchdog

1

Supplier_package

SOIC W

Specifications

https://4donline.ihs.com/images/VipMasterIC/IC/MCHP/MCHP-S-A0001693106/MCHP-S-A0001693106-1.pdf?hkey=52A5661711E402568146F3353EA87419

Screening_level

Industrial

Schedule_b

8542310000

Ram_size

512 byte

Program_memory_type

Flash

Program_memory_size

8 KB

Product_dimensions

17.87 x 7.49 x 2.31 mm

Pin_count

28

Operating_temperature

-40 to 85 °C

On_chip_adc

10-chx10-bit

Бренд

Number_of_timers

5

Number_of_programmable_i_os

25

Msl_level

1, 3

Mounting

Surface Mount

Maximum_speed

40 MHz

Max_processing_temp

260

Lead_finish

Matte Tin

Тип интерфейса

I2C/SPI/USART

Instruction_set_architecture

RISC

Htsn

8542310001

Eccn

EAR99

Device_core

PIC

Data_bus_width

8 Bit

Country_of_origin

China

Max_power_dissipation

1000 mW

SKU: PIC18LF2320-I/SO

Description

PIC18LF2320 offers the advantages of all PIC18 microcontrollers ñ namely, high computational performance at an economical price with the addition of highendurance Enhanced Flash program memory. On top of these features, the PIC18F2220/2320/4220/4320 family introduces design enhancements that make these microcontrollers a logical choice for many high-performance, power sensitive applications. All of the devices in the PIC18F2220/2320/4220/4320 family incorporate a range of features that can significantly reduce power consumption during operation Alternate Run Modes: By clocking the controller from the Timer1 source or the internal oscillator block, power consumption during code execution can be reduced by as much as 90% Multiple Idle Modes: The controller can also run with its CPU core disabled, but the peripherals are still active. In these states, power consumption can be reduced even further, to as little as 4%, of normal operation requirements. On-the-Fly Mode Switching: The power-managed modes are invoked by user code during operation, allowing the user to incorporate power-saving ideas into their applicationís software design. Lower Consumption in Key Modules: The power requirements for both Timer1 and the Watchdog Timer have been reduced by up to 80%, with typical values of 1.8 and 2.2 µA, respectively. All of the devices in the PIC18F2220/2320/4220/4320 family offer nine different oscillator options, allowing users a wide range of choices in developing application hardware. These include: ï Four Crystal modes using crystals or ceramic resonators. ï Two External Clock modes offering the option of using two pins (oscillator input and a divide-by-4 clock output) or one pin (oscillator input with the second pin reassigned as general I/O). ï Two External RC Oscillator modes with the same pin options as the External Clock modes. ï An internal oscillator block, which provides a 31 kHz INTRC clock and an 8 MHz clock with 6 program selectable divider ratios (4 MHz to 125 kHz) for a total of 8 clock frequencies Besides its availability as a clock source, the internal oscillator block provides a stable reference source that gives the family additional features for robust operation: Fail-Safe Clock Monitor: This option constantly monitors the main clock source against a reference signal provided by the internal oscillator. If a clock failure occurs, the controller is switched to the internal oscillator block, allowing for continued low-speed operation or a safe application shutdown. Two-Speed Start-up: This option allows the internal oscillator to serve as the clock source from Power-on Reset, or wake-up from Sleep mode, until the primary clock source is available. This allows for code execution during what would otherwise be the clock start-up interval and can even allow an application to perform routine background activities and return to Sleep without returning to full power operation. Memory Endurance: The Enhanced Flash cells for both program memory and data EEPROM are rated to last for many thousands of erase/write cycles ñ up to 100,000 for program memory and 1,000,000 for EEPROM. Data retention without refresh is conservatively estimated to be greater than 40 years

  • Low-Power Features:
  • Power-Managed modes:
    • Run: CPU on, peripherals on
    • Idle: CPU off, peripherals on
    • Sleep: CPU off, peripherals off
  • Power Consumption modes:
    • PRI_RUN: 150 µA, 1 MHz, 2V
    • PRI_IDLE: 37 µA, 1 MHz, 2V
    • SEC_RUN: 14 µA, 32 kHz, 2V
    • SEC_IDLE: 5.8 µA, 32 kHz, 2V
    • RC_RUN: 110 µA, 1 MHz, 2V
    • RC_IDLE: 52 µA, 1 MHz, 2V
    • Sleep: 0.1 µA, 1 MHz, 2V
  • Timer1 Oscillator: 1.1 µA, 32 kHz, 2V
  • Watchdog Timer: 2.1 µA
  • Two-Speed Oscillator Start-up Oscillators:
  • Four Crystal modes:
    • LP, XT, HS: up to 25 MHz
    • HSPLL: 4-10 MHz (16-40 MHz internal)
  • Two External RC modes, Up to 4 MHz
  • Two External Clock modes, Up to 40 MHz
  • Internal Oscillator Block:
    • 8 user-selectable frequencies: 31 kHz, 125 kHz, 250 kHz, 500 kHz, 1 MHz, 2 MHz, 4 MHz, 8 MHz
    • 125 kHz-8 MHz calibrated to 1%
    • Two modes select one or two I/O pins
    • OSCTUNE Allows user to shift frequency
  • Secondary Oscillator using Timer1 @ 32 kHz
  • Fail-Safe Clock Monitor
    • Allows for safe shutdown if peripheral clock stops
  • Peripheral Highlights:
  • High-Current Sink/Source 25 mA/25 mA
  • Three External Interrupts
  • Up to 2 Capture/Compare/PWM (CCP) modules:
    • Capture is 16-bit, max. resolution is 6.25 ns (TCY/16)
    • Compare is 16-bit, max. resolution is 100 ns (TCY)
    • PWM output: PWM resolution is 1 to 10-bit
  • Enhanced Capture/Compare/PWM (ECCP) module:
    • One, two or four PWM outputs
    • Selectable polarity
    • Programmable dead time
    • Auto-Shutdown and Auto-Restart
  • Compatible 10-Bit, Up to 13-Channel Analog-to-Digital Converter (A/D) module with Programmable Acquisition Time
  • Dual Analog Comparators
  • Addressable USART module:
    • RS-232 operation using internal oscillator block (no external crystal required) Special Microcontroller Features:
  • 100,000 Erase/Write Cycle Enhanced Flash Program Memory Typical
  • 1,000,000 Erase/Write Cycle Data EEPROM Memory Typical
  • Flash/Data EEPROM Retention: > 40 Years
  • Self-Programmable under Software Control
  • Priority Levels for Interrupts
  • 8 x 8 Single-Cycle Hardware Multiplier
  • Extended Watchdog Timer (WDT):
    • Programmable period from 41 ms to 131s
    • 2% stability over VDD and Temperature
  • Single-Supply 5V In-Circuit Serial Programmingô (ICSPô) via Two Pins
  • In-Circuit Debug (ICD) via Two Pins
  • Wide Operating Voltage Range: 2.0V to 5.5V

Additional information

Analog_comparators

2

Operating_supply_voltage

2.5, 3.3, 5 V

Min_operating_supply_voltage

2 V

Max_operating_supply_voltage

5.5 V

Watchdog

1

Supplier_package

SOIC W

Specifications

https://4donline.ihs.com/images/VipMasterIC/IC/MCHP/MCHP-S-A0001693106/MCHP-S-A0001693106-1.pdf?hkey=52A5661711E402568146F3353EA87419

Screening_level

Industrial

Schedule_b

8542310000

Ram_size

512 byte

Program_memory_type

Flash

Program_memory_size

8 KB

Product_dimensions

17.87 x 7.49 x 2.31 mm

Pin_count

28

Operating_temperature

-40 to 85 °C

On_chip_adc

10-chx10-bit

Бренд

Number_of_timers

5

Number_of_programmable_i_os

25

Msl_level

1, 3

Mounting

Surface Mount

Maximum_speed

40 MHz

Max_processing_temp

260

Lead_finish

Matte Tin

Тип интерфейса

I2C/SPI/USART

Instruction_set_architecture

RISC

Htsn

8542310001

Eccn

EAR99

Device_core

PIC

Data_bus_width

8 Bit

Country_of_origin

China

Max_power_dissipation

1000 mW